3.03 Reporting and Resolving Discrepancies <br />A. Reporting Discrepancies: <br />Contractor's Review of Contract Documents Before Starting Work: Before undertaking each <br />part of the Work, Contractor shall carefully study and compare the Contract Documents and <br />check and verify pertinent figures therein and all applicable field measurements. Contractor <br />shall promptly report in writing to Engineer any conflict, error, ambiguity, or discrepancy <br />which Contractor discovers, or has actual knowledge of, and shall obtain a written <br />interpretation or clarification from Engineer before proceeding with any Work affected <br />thereby. <br />2. Contractor's Review of Contract Documents During Performance of Work: If, during the <br />performance of the Work, Contractor discovers any conflict, error, ambiguity, or discrepancy <br />within the Contract Documents, or between the Contract Documents and (a) any applicable <br />Law or Regulation , (b) any standard, specification, manual, or code, or (c) any instruction of <br />any Supplier, then Contractor shall promptly report it to Engineer in writing. Contractor shall <br />not proceed with the Work affected thereby (except in an emergency as required by Paragraph <br />6.16.A) until an amendment or supplement to the Contract Documents has been issued by <br />one of the methods indicated in Paragraph 3.04. <br />3. Contractor shall not be liable to Owner or Engineer for failure to report any conflict, error, <br />ambiguity, or discrepancy in the Contract Documents unless Contractor had actual <br />knowledge thereof. <br />B. Resolving Discrepancies: <br />1. Except as may be otherwise specifically stated in the Contract Documents, the provisions of <br />the Contract Documents shall take precedence in resolving any conflict, error, ambiguity, or <br />discrepancy between the provisions of the Contract Documents and: <br />a. the provisions of any standard, specification, manual, or code, or the instruction of any <br />Supplier (whether or not specifically incorporated by reference in the Contract <br />Documents); or <br />b. the provisions of any Laws or Regulations applicable to the performance of the Work <br />(unless such an interpretation of the provisions of the Contract Documents would result in <br />violation of such Law or Regulation). <br />3.04 Amending and Supplementing Contract Documents <br />A. The Contract Documents may be amended to provide for additions, deletions, and revisions in <br />the Work or to modify the terms and conditions thereof by either a Change Order or a Work <br />Change Directive. <br />B.
